Overview Cipmolnu 200 Capsule

Molnupiravir 200mg capsules represent a pioneering oral antiviral therapy for managing mild to moderate COVID-19 in adult patients. Its mechanism involves inhibiting viral replication, consequently lowering viral burden and disease intensity. This medication received emergency authorization from Indian regulatory bodies on December 28, 2021. Molnupiravir 200mg is exclusively prescribed for adults experiencing mild to moderate COVID-19 symptoms and exhibiting a heightened risk of severe illness. Risk factors include advanced age (over 60), obesity, diabetes, and cardiovascular conditions. It's contraindicated for individuals requiring immediate hospitalization for COVID-19. The drug has also gained emergency use approval from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and the UK's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A). The oral course should not exceed five consecutive days. Treatment completion is crucial; discontinue only under medical supervision. Potential side effects, including nausea, diarrhea, headache, and dizziness, should be reported to a physician for appropriate management. Prior to commencing treatment, patients should disclose all pre-existing health conditions and concurrent medications to their healthcare provider. Use during pregnancy is discouraged, and pregnant or breastfeeding individuals must consult their doctor before use.

How Cipmolnu 200 Capsule works:

Cipmolnu 200 Capsules offer antiviral action by suppressing SARS-CoV-2 replication. This mechanism prevents further viral proliferation, thus reducing the overall viral burden within the patient.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The interaction of Cipmolnu 200 Capsule with alcohol is uncertain. Seek medical advice before combining them.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Cipmolnu 200 Cap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the unborn child. A physician will assess the potential advantages against any poss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ingUNSAFE

Use of Cipmolnu 200 Capsules while breastfeeding is contraindicated due to potential infant toxicity.

DrivingDr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The effect of Cipmolnu 200 Capsule on driving ability is undetermined. Refrain from operating a vehicle if experiencing sym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Cipmolnu 200 Capsules pose no safety concerns for patients with kidney impairment; no dosage modification is necessary.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Cipmolnu 200 Capsules may be administered to patients with hepatic impairment without modification of the prescribed dosage.

FAQs on Cipmolnu 200 Capsule

Cipmolnu 200 Capsules are not approved for use in individuals under 18 due to potential interference with bone and cartilage development.
Cipmolnu 200 Capsules offer improved patient adherence compared to certain other COVID-19 treatments. Its oral administration simplifies usage, eliminating the need for a healthcare professional to administer the medication; patients simply take it by mouth as directed by their physician.
Cipmolnu 200 Capsule carries significant risks, potentially causing birth defects in pregnant women and severe bone and cartilage damage, leading to muscle problems. Use is strictly limited to doctor-prescribed treatment; self-medication is strongly discouraged.
No, they are entirely different. Cipmolnu 200 Capsules are not a vaccination replacement. Vaccines prevent COVID-19, whereas Cipmolnu 200 Capsules treat early-stage infections.
Individuals at heightened risk of severe COVID-19 are those over 60, obese, or with pre-existing conditions such as high blood pressure, diabetes, asthma, lung or kidney disease (including dialysis patients), liver disease, or weakened immunity (e.g., cancer patients).
Cipmolnu 200 Capsules are not for COVID-19 prevention or treatment in hospitalized patients. Ongoing clinical trials show no benefit for those severely ill with COVID-19.
